The Mogami Gold Studio 1/4" TRS-Female XLR Cable is engineered to provide an enhanced dynamic range and pin-drop quiet recording environment. This professional cable is ideal for any XLR-Female to 1/4" TRS balanced connection in studios and on stages.
Quad Cable Construction for Unparalleled Clarity
Mogami Gold Studio Cables are wired with Mogami's renowned Neglex Quad High Definition Microphone Cable, a balanced 4-conductor cable praised for its superior clarity and remarkable noise cancelation. Mogami's quad cable design improves the rejection of noise and RF interference by up to 95% compared to the best 2-conductor cables.
Wide Frequency Response and Low Distortion
With a wide frequency response and minimal distortion, the Mogami Gold Studio 1/4" TRS-Female XLR Cable provides an accurate and transparent signal for high-fidelity recording and monitoring applications. Its shielding protects against electrostatic and magnetic interference to deliver a clean, interference-free signal over long cable runs.

Microphonic cable
I got this cable because I needed something to run a mic into the TRS mic input in my Kustom Sienna 30 acoustic amp. I admit I haven't played with it a lot yet, but when I turned up the level, the cable became extremely microphonic - that is it made noise every time I moved it. Even just brushing my finger against it. None of my cheap cables do this. It's not a huge deal because I'm just using the cable in a studio setting, but I was surprised that this happened given all the positive reviews I had read about Mogami cables. Overall, the cable sounds good and provides good clarity when you're not moving it, but personally I think it was a waste of money and if I hadn't thrown away all the packaging I would be returning it.
